Light up your life—without the guilt! OREiN's smart bulbs are like the superheroes of lighting: they pack a punch with 1100 lumens (that's a 75W equivalent, for those keeping score) while sipping on energy like it's a fine wine. Seriously, they use 85% less power than those old-school bulbs. Perfect for when you're chopping veggies in the kitchen, tinkering in the garage, or pretending to work in your home office.
Tired of playing app hopscotch? These bulbs are Matter-certified, which means they play nice with Alexa, Apple Home, Google Home, and SmartThings. Just hook 'em up to your existing Matter speaker (iOS 16.5+ or Android 8.1+, no excuses) and voilà—your smart home just got smarter. Whether you're Team iPhone or Team Android, we've got you covered.
Ever wanted your lights to throw a party? With OREiN's music sync feature, your bulbs will groove to the beat, changing colors like they're at a rave. Pick your vibe—Party, Dynamic, Calm, or let the Auto Rhythm do its thing—all through the Aidot app. Because why should speakers have all the fun?
And because we know you've got secrets (who doesn't?), these bulbs come with top-notch security. Matter's got your back with some serious cryptographic algorithms, keeping every message under lock and key. Plus, with frequent OTA updates, your privacy stays future-proof.
